We describe how the resolution of a kernel-based interpolation problem can be associated with a spectral problem. An integral operator is defined from the embedding of the considered Hilbert subspace into an auxiliary Hilbert space of square-integrable functions. We finally obtain a spectral representation of the interpolating elements which allows their approximation by spectral truncation.
